Transaction 58c9fa22e4728ffef7a218c00533f0c3dd96d3659f2f96b5fc80c76f2808756e

3 Input
2 Outputs
  • 58c9fa22e4728ffef7a218c00533f0c3dd96d3659f2f96b5fc80c76f2808756e:0
  • value  524154
    address  1BFbQbhJtZfuE1678U92KZc5o9GvpELWjM
  • 58c9fa22e4728ffef7a218c00533f0c3dd96d3659f2f96b5fc80c76f2808756e:1
  • value  1070768
    address  3Dj5YEg5s6wE3Ds5ZxLZCb7NuoeDULvg4v